반응형
2. strict 모드
ECMAScript 5에서 추가된 기능으로서, 느슨한 Javascript에 강력한 제약조건을 설정할 수 있다. 대표적으로 변수 선언시 반드시 var 사용해야 된다.
기존에는 var를 사용하지 않더라도 에러가 나지 않고 알아서 처리해줬지만 "use strict"를 사용하면 변수 선언을 해주지 않았기 때문에 에러가 발생한다.
해당 모드는 블록 scope 기준을 따른다.
선언된 위치에 따라 적용되는 범위가 다르다.
반응형
'개발 언어 > ECMAScript6' 카테고리의 다른 글
05 ECMAScript6 - 디스트럭처링 (De-structuring) (0) | 2018.04.02 |
---|---|
04 ECMAScript6 - function 2 (람다 함수, arrow 함수, generator) (0) | 2018.04.02 |
04 ECMAScript6 - function 1 (default, rest, spread) (0) | 2018.04.02 |
03 ESMAScript6 - let & const (0) | 2018.04.02 |
01 ECMAScript6란 (개요, 개념) (0) | 2018.04.02 |
댓글